[發明專利]選擇非最小路徑和節流端口速度以增大網絡吞吐量的技術在審
| 申請號: | 201810980069.3 | 申請日: | 2018-08-27 |
| 公開(公告)號: | CN109561020A | 公開(公告)日: | 2019-04-02 |
| 發明(設計)人: | M.弗拉斯利克;E.R.博爾奇;T.施奈德;M.A.帕克 | 申請(專利權)人: | 英特爾公司 |
| 主分類號: | H04L12/721 | 分類號: | H04L12/721;H04L12/729;H04L12/801 |
| 代理公司: | 中國專利代理(香港)有限公司 72001 | 代理人: | 姜冰;楊美靈 |
| 地址: | 美國加利*** | 國省代碼: | 美國;US |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 節點交換機 最小路徑 數據傳輸性能 傳輸性能 期望數據 測量 期望性能 性能數據 指示節點 交換機 網絡吞吐量 比較測量 輸出端口 節流 與非 吞吐量 發送 關聯 響應 改進 網絡 | ||
用于改進網絡中吞吐量的技術包括節點交換機。節點交換機將獲得指示節點交換機的期望數據傳輸性能的期望性能數據。節點交換機也將獲得指示節點交換機的測量的數據傳輸性能的測量的性能數據,比較測量的性能數據和期望性能數據以確定測量的數據傳輸性能是否滿足期望數據傳輸性能,根據測量的數據傳輸性能是否滿足期望數據傳輸性能,確定是否強制數據的單元通過非最小路徑到目的地,以及響應于確定強制數據的單元要通過非最小路徑被發送,向與非最小路徑關聯的節點交換機的輸出端口發送數據的單元。也描述了其它實施例。
有關聯邦贊助的研究的聲明
本發明是在國防部授予的編號為H98230A-13-D-0124的合同下在具有政府支持的情況下做出的。政府擁有本發明中的某些權利。
背景技術
在一些高性能網絡拓撲(本文中稱為構造(fabric))中,網絡公平性是在為許多類的應用保持目標性能中的重要因素。網絡公平性能夠被定義為在許多節點(例如,產生和/或消耗通過網絡發送的數據的計算裝置)之中分配網絡資源(例如,帶寬),使得資源不被不按比例地分配給一個節點,損害網絡中的一個或多個其它節點。對公平性特別敏感的應用包括使用全局同步或局部同步(例如,等待在鄰居交換中的所有消息)的那些應用。在此類應用中,由群組中的最慢節點來確定性能,因此強調公平性。
分級網絡按照設計在許多流之中共享鏈路以達到高利用率。因此,它們易于發生對于許多業務模式(traffic pattern)的網絡不公平性。在一個或多個交換機在網絡中使得源與目的地之間的路徑飽和,導致對于嘗試通過該路徑發送數據的任何其它節點的擁塞和高等待時間時,不公平性能夠發生。在連接到節點集的交換機的一個或多個端口具有比連接到其它節點的交換機的其它端口更高的吞吐量時,不公平性能夠也發生在交換機內。因此,連接到更慢端口的節點不能與連接到相同交換機的更快端口的節點按照相同的速度注入數據。
附圖說明
在本文中描述的概念在附圖中以示例而非限制的方式被圖示。為了說明的簡明和清晰,圖中所示元素不一定按比例畫出。在認為適當之處,參考標號已在圖中重復以指示對應的或類似的元素。
圖1是用于管理公平性以改進在網絡中的吞吐量的系統的至少一個實施例的簡化框圖;
圖2是圖1的系統的節點交換機的至少一個實施例的簡化框圖;
圖3是可由圖1和2的節點交換機建立的環境的簡化框圖;
圖4-8是可由圖1-3的節點交換機執行的,用于管理公平性的方法的至少一個實施例的簡化流程圖;
圖9是邏輯組件的至少一個實施例的簡化框圖,邏輯組件可由圖1-3的節點交換機利用來強制選擇用于通過網絡發送數據的單元的非最小路徑,以改進公平性;
圖10是邏輯組件的至少一個實施例的簡化框圖,邏輯組件可由圖1-3的節點交換機利用來節流節點交換機的節點端口以改進公平性;以及
圖11是邏輯組件的至少一個實施例的簡化框圖,邏輯組件可由圖1-3的節點交換機利用來使用信用方案實行對于節點交換機的節點端口的數據傳輸速率。
具體實施方式
盡管本公開的概念容許各種修改和備選形式,但其特定實施例已在圖中通過示例被示出,并且將在本文中被詳細描述。然而,應理解的是,不存在將本公開的概念限制到所公開的具體形式的意圖,而是與之相反,意圖是要覆蓋與本公開和隨附權利要求一致的所有修改、等同物和替代方案。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于英特爾公司,未經英特爾公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201810980069.3/2.html,轉載請聲明來源鉆瓜專利網。





